What is a commercial building curtain wall system?
The most common commercial building curtain wall systems consist of sealed double-glazed windows in an aluminum frame that may or may not incorporate any kind of thermal break. Insulated spandrel panels generally consist of an insulated metal pan installed in the same framing system as the windows.
How many spans can a steel curtain wall support?
Depending on project criteria, steel curtain walls using continuous steel back mullions can support up to 40 feet spans in a single member without splicing. This, of course, is dependent on variables such as center-to-center location of vertical members, span length and structural loads.
Do curtain wall systems control heat flow?
The quest for improved curtain wall systems has led design engineers to concentrate their efforts on the management of moisture and control of heat flow. In terms of heat flow, the general focus in recent years has been on the vision areas of the curtain wall, not the spandrel areas.

Do steel curtain wall and window systems support high-efficiency glass units?
It is important to note that while steel curtain wall and window systems can support high-efficiency glass units, it is still crucial they account for changing sun angles and solar heat gain. Incorporating shading devices—such as exterior mounted sunshades in the 804 Carnegie Center—can help lessen direct solar transmittance through the glass.
